Output 9407aa68fae4951060af5892e6c1bb9605884f7432ed628125e2f84617f050db:109

value
343393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b546e0b282f2ff40459c33a6316632eedc1400e OP_EQUAL
address
3P9KruvTtp3tY7Hv8QFULsABt4xns6WXbn
transaction
9407aa68fae4951060af5892e6c1bb9605884f7432ed628125e2f84617f050db